Searched refs:wil_w (Results 1 – 5 of 5) sorted by relevance
/linux-4.4.14/drivers/net/wireless/ath/wil6210/ |
D | interrupt.c | 79 wil_w(wil, RGF_DMA_EP_TX_ICR + offsetof(struct RGF_ICR, IMS), in wil6210_mask_irq_tx() 85 wil_w(wil, RGF_DMA_EP_RX_ICR + offsetof(struct RGF_ICR, IMS), in wil6210_mask_irq_rx() 91 wil_w(wil, RGF_DMA_EP_MISC_ICR + offsetof(struct RGF_ICR, IMS), in wil6210_mask_irq_misc() 99 wil_w(wil, RGF_DMA_PSEUDO_CAUSE_MASK_SW, WIL6210_IRQ_DISABLE); in wil6210_mask_irq_pseudo() 106 wil_w(wil, RGF_DMA_EP_TX_ICR + offsetof(struct RGF_ICR, IMC), in wil6210_unmask_irq_tx() 112 wil_w(wil, RGF_DMA_EP_RX_ICR + offsetof(struct RGF_ICR, IMC), in wil6210_unmask_irq_rx() 118 wil_w(wil, RGF_DMA_EP_MISC_ICR + offsetof(struct RGF_ICR, IMC), in wil6210_unmask_irq_misc() 128 wil_w(wil, RGF_DMA_PSEUDO_CAUSE_MASK_SW, WIL6210_IRQ_PSEUDO_MASK); in wil6210_unmask_irq_pseudo() 145 wil_w(wil, RGF_DMA_EP_RX_ICR + offsetof(struct RGF_ICR, ICC), in wil_unmask_irq() 147 wil_w(wil, RGF_DMA_EP_TX_ICR + offsetof(struct RGF_ICR, ICC), in wil_unmask_irq() [all …]
|
D | main.c | 535 wil_w(wil, RGF_USER_USER_CPU_0, BIT_USER_USER_CPU_MAN_RST); in wil_halt_cpu() 536 wil_w(wil, RGF_USER_MAC_CPU_0, BIT_USER_MAC_CPU_MAN_RST); in wil_halt_cpu() 542 wil_w(wil, RGF_USER_USER_CPU_0, 1); in wil_release_cpu() 560 wil_w(wil, RGF_USER_BL + in wil_target_reset() 579 wil_w(wil, RGF_USER_CLKS_CTL_EXT_SW_RST_VEC_0, 0x3ff81f); in wil_target_reset() 580 wil_w(wil, RGF_USER_CLKS_CTL_EXT_SW_RST_VEC_1, 0xf); in wil_target_reset() 582 wil_w(wil, RGF_USER_CLKS_CTL_SW_RST_VEC_2, 0xFE000000); in wil_target_reset() 583 wil_w(wil, RGF_USER_CLKS_CTL_SW_RST_VEC_1, 0x0000003F); in wil_target_reset() 584 wil_w(wil, RGF_USER_CLKS_CTL_SW_RST_VEC_3, 0x000000f0); in wil_target_reset() 585 wil_w(wil, RGF_USER_CLKS_CTL_SW_RST_VEC_0, 0xFFE7FE00); in wil_target_reset() [all …]
|
D | wil6210.h | 668 static inline void wil_w(struct wil6210_priv *wil, u32 reg, u32 val) in wil_w() function 677 wil_w(wil, reg, wil_r(wil, reg) | val); in wil_s() 683 wil_w(wil, reg, wil_r(wil, reg) & ~val); in wil_c()
|
D | wmi.c | 257 wil_w(wil, r->head + offsetof(struct wil6210_mbox_ring_desc, sync), 1); in __wmi_send() 259 wil_w(wil, RGF_MBOX + offsetof(struct wil6210_mbox_ctl, tx.head), in __wmi_send() 265 wil_w(wil, RGF_USER_USER_ICR + offsetof(struct RGF_ICR, ICS), in __wmi_send() 775 wil_w(wil, r->tail + in wmi_recv_cmd() 795 wil_w(wil, RGF_MBOX + in wmi_recv_cmd()
|
D | txrx.c | 546 wil_w(wil, v->hwtail, v->swtail); in wil_rx_refill() 1471 wil_w(wil, vring->hwtail, vring->swhead); in __wil_tx_vring_tso() 1613 wil_w(wil, vring->hwtail, vring->swhead); in __wil_tx_vring()
|